The embodiment of the invention provides a method and a device for keeping communication of an unmanned ship, the unmanned ship and a computer storage medium. The method comprises the following steps: acquiring inertial measurement data of the unmanned ship; acquiring Z-axis direction data of the unmanned ship according to the inertial measurement data of the unmanned ship; and judging whether the Z-axis direction data of the unmanned ship is abnormal or not, and if yes, rotating a radio frequency antenna of the unmanned ship by a preset angle. The technical problem that in the prior art, normal communication cannot be achieved after an unmanned ship captures is solved.
